Stand out as a civically engaged professional writer

Professional writers are critical in the modern workforce. Through clear and concise written communication, you will solve real world problems by creating meaning from complex and abstract ideas.

With your bachelor’s degree in writing and rhetoric earned through UCF Online, you’ll have the tools to become a persuasive and ethical communicator. This program transcends a foundational understanding of communication and engages in a modern, practical application of written communication spanning mediums, including written, digital and multimedia texts. Through a variety of writing and theory-based courses, you’ll learn how to engage in strategies that produce impactful written assets that can persuade, inform, or sell.

UCF Online’s writing and rhetoric Bachelor of Art degree is offered entirely online. Upon graduation, you’ll be ready to step into a wide variety of professional writing careers or to pursue an advanced degree. Get started today to earn your B.A. in Writing and Rhetoric.

Course Overview

Writing and Rhetoric Foundations

An introduction to and application of rhetorical skills and concepts that enable advanced (inter)disciplinary writing and research within and beyond the university

Engage in a study of and practice with professional writing as a rhetorical act involving problem solving and audience accommodation; includes research and text production practices as well as business genres and conventions

Explore the relationship between rhetoric and civic life. Analyzes and practices rhetorical actions for becoming civically engaged
